Mybatis的Mapper文件sql語句中使用常量值或者枚舉常量值


枚舉

'${@全路徑名@枚舉值.get屬性()}',則會解析出枚舉值的屬性常量值,放入sql語句中。
這里單引號’'是因為${}占位符只是把值給填充進去,要表示字符串的話,加上單引號,不是字符串則不用加

常量

'${@全路徑名@常量名}',會解析出常量值,放入sql語句中。

其實,方法、屬性等也可以解析出來,就如同:類.靜態屬性、類.靜態方法()。

注:內部類用$


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M